Mitigating Risks in Steel Supply Chains

The steel supply chain is a complex web that involves various stages, from raw material extraction to production and delivery to end-users. Given its complexity, the steel supply chain is susceptible to numerous risks that can disrupt operations and affect profitability. This blog explores the key risks associated with steel supply chains and provides actionable strategies to mitigate them.

Understanding the Risks
Steel supply chains face several types of risks, including:

Supply Disruptions: Natural disasters, geopolitical tensions, and logistical challenges can disrupt the supply of raw materials like iron ore and coal.
Price Volatility: Fluctuations in the prices of raw materials and finished steel products can significantly impact profit margins.
Quality Issues: Variations in the quality of raw materials and production processes can lead to defects in the final product, affecting customer satisfaction and increasing costs.
Regulatory Changes: Changes in environmental regulations and trade policies can alter the operational landscape, leading to increased compliance costs and potential supply chain adjustments.
Operational Inefficiencies: Inefficiencies in production processes, transportation, and inventory management can lead to delays and increased costs.
Strategies for Risk Mitigation
Diversifying Suppliers: Relying on a single supplier for critical raw materials can be risky. Building relationships with multiple suppliers in different regions can provide a buffer against supply disruptions.

Example: A steel manufacturer might source iron ore from both Australia and Brazil to mitigate the risk of disruption from a supplier-specific issue.

Implementing Hedging Strategies: To manage price volatility, companies can use financial instruments like futures and options to hedge against adverse price movements.

Example: A steel company might lock in the price of coal through futures contracts, ensuring stable costs over a specified period.

Investing in Quality Control: Establishing rigorous quality control processes at every stage of the supply chain can help detect and address quality issues early.

Example: Regular audits and testing of raw materials before they enter the production line can prevent the production of defective steel products.

Staying Compliant with Regulations: Keeping abreast of regulatory changes and proactively adjusting operations to comply with new standards can prevent costly fines and disruptions.

Example: Investing in cleaner technologies to meet stricter environmental regulations can not only ensure compliance but also enhance the company’s reputation.

Enhancing Operational Efficiency: Implementing advanced technologies such as IoT, AI, and automation can streamline operations, reduce waste, and improve overall efficiency.

Example: Using predictive analytics to forecast demand and optimize inventory levels can reduce holding costs and prevent stockouts.
